How they compare
Paraguay currently reports 26.7 against 26.7 in Peru, a difference of 0.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 42 shared years of data; in 1975 it was Peru ahead.
Paraguay ranks 65th and Peru ranks 65th of 189 countries.
Across the 5 decades both report, Paraguay averaged higher in 1 and Peru in 4.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Paraguay | Peru |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1970s | 22.4 | 23.1 | 0.7 | Peru |
| 1980s | 23.25 | 23.76 | 0.51 | Peru |
| 1990s | 24.33 | 24.57 | 0.24 | Peru |
| 2000s | 25.42 | 25.45 | 0.03 | Peru |
| 2010s | 26.39 | 26.31 | 0.0714 | Paraguay |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
